"Artful Antics: A Book of Art, Music, and Theater Jokes" by Jill L. Donahue is a delightful collection that celebrates the lighter side of the creative world. Filled with puns, witty observations, and humorous anecdotes, this book invites readers to enjoy laugh-out-loud moments inspired by various art forms. From clever quips about famous artists to amusing tales from the theater and catchy jests related to music, Donahue’s playful prose captures the essence of creativity in a whimsical way. Perfect for artists, performers, and anyone who appreciates the arts, this book brings merriment and joy through the universal language of laughter.
